Starring Charlie Hunnam as Jackson ‘Jax’ Teller, son of the creator of the motorcycle club, which now finds itself under his step dad’s leadership. Not sure that he approves of the lawlessness of what the group is now doing, he must deal with an internal moral conflict between what is right for his band of brothers and what is right on his conscious.
Premiering this November 21, Sunday at 9PM with back-to-back episodes on Jack TV, Sons of Anarchy Season 2 sees the club having to deal with a white separatist group named League of American Nationalists (LOAN) who seeks to drive them out of town. Entangled in the drama is Jax’s mom Gemma (Katey Sagal) who finds herself kidnapped and being used as messenger between the two warring groups.

Determined to keep his power and rule in town, Clarence ‘Clay’ Morrow (Ron Perlman), the step dad of Jax and current President of the Sons of Anarchy decides that retaliation is needed. But whatever plans he may have is he ready for the consequences that lay before him and the other riders?
Sons of Anarchy is a highly adrenalized drama that chronicles a notorious outlaw motorcycle club who patrols their simple town against drug dealers, corporate developers, nosy law enforcers and competing gangs.
